How much should I budget for vacation per year?

How much should I budget for vacation per year?

Other sources, Credit Donkey, suggest that Americans spend $1,145 per person for the average vacation. While the results of a Bankrate survey say that Americans plan to spend over $1,900 on their vacations. The Baby Boomer generation spends about $6,600 on vacations each year, on average.

How much can I afford to spend on vacation?

Say you normally spend all but $200 of your paycheck per month on living costs. You might cut back on some luxuries, like restaurant meals, and boost that monthly savings to $300. If you’re not traveling for another four months, that’s $1,200 you can put toward your vacation.

What is the average vacation cost?

The average cost of a one-week vacation in the U.S. for one person is $1,558. The average cost for a one-week vacation in the U.S. for two people is $3,116. The average nightly cost of a double-occupancy hotel room in the U.S. is $204.

How much does a vacation for 4 cost?

The average person spends around $1,200 on vacation per year. For a family of 4, this means around $4,800. This can equal as much as 8-9% of the average household income. This amount takes into account transportation, lodging, food, and entertainment.

What is the 80/20 rule budget?

Key Takeaways. With the 80/20 rule of thumb for budgeting, you put 20% of your take-home pay into savings. The remaining 80% is for spending. It’s a simplified version of the 50/30/20 rule of thumb, which allocates 50% of your take-home pay to needs, 30% to wants, and 20% to saving.
